2. GENERAL REPAIR INFORMATION
These section provides useful repair information how to carry out repairs:
o
To familiarize oneself with NOKIA product read the tutorials or user guide on www.nokia.com -->Support-->
Phones, by selecting the Phone Model.
o
Before starting repairs you must observe ESD precautions such as being in your ESD Protected Area and
connecting your wristband.
o Use gloves to avoid corrosion and fingerprints.
o
Protect windows and displays with a film to avoid dust and scratches.
o
Use a lint-free cloth (e.g…..) to clean the LCD(e.g. Micro-Fibre cloth).
o
When cleaning the pads use a soft cloth/ESD brush and Isopropanol. Do not use a glass fiber pencil this
scratches the surface and will cause corrosion.
o Non faulty Mechanical parts (except shielding lids and bent or soldered components ), may be reused, if they
are not soldered.
o
When removing the shielding lids make sure to replace them with new ones, otherwise the high-frequency
leakage can affect the device.
o Always use original NOKIA spare parts.
o Check the soldering joints of the parts, concerned which regard to the fault symptom (e.g. soldered connectors
or switches) and resolder them if necessary (Level 2 only).
o Remove excess soldering flux after repair.
o Observe the torque requirements when assembling the unit.
o Preferably use your own equipment for testing. E.g. if the customer complains about charger function, please
test the phone with your own charger to determine if phone or charger causes the malfunction.
o
A SIM card is needed for all GoNoGo tests.
o
When doing the fault log entries, always note the Item code of the part that caused the malfunction. Also fill
in the appropriate part code from the assembly if needed.
o
Please be aware that some malfunctions may be software related and solved by an update.
